Есть ли какой-нибудь стандарт для поиска (в потоках) по HTTP? - PullRequest
3 голосов
/ 18 мая 2011

Я знаю, что в настоящее время HTML5-совместимые браузеры используют заголовок Accept-Ranges для поиска внутри потоков, но это далеко не идеальное решение.Браузер нуждается в полной информации индекса файла, чтобы сделать это эффективно, и это невозможно для оптимизированных потоковых форматов, таких как фрагментированный mp4 и chunked mkv (или WebM).

Существует ли функция HTTP или расширение, которое работает с метками времени (вместо байтов).

Я знаю, что такой стандарт вряд ли поддерживается в браузерахтем не менее, с этими ранними реализациями.Мне просто интересно, существует ли даже такой стандарт или предложение.

1 Ответ

2 голосов
/ 18 мая 2011

Нет, протокол http не знает о содержании в теле как таковом.Возможно, вы сможете запустить cgi, который доставит файл, и он примет отметку времени в качестве параметра для продолжения потока с этой позиции.

...